Home NAS basing on OpenSolaris/ZFS

shuttle_SG33G5和很多第一批的Time Capsule用户一样,18月过后,我的TC-1TB死了,估计是电容击穿了。拿到苹果维修中心,人家说只能采用调换维修的方式,因为过保,要收费4,800元,而买一台全新的才2,300多。回到家,把TC拆了,将硬盘取出来,放到刚买的一个USB外置硬盘盒里,硬盘盒居然点不亮,心里一下就毛了,直想骂娘。要知道,我给儿子拍的照片和视频,还有积攒的很多电子书和资料,可都在里面呢。极其后悔,当初没把重要的数据刻盘备份。

第二天早起去鼎好,发现是店家给我的电源线有问题。插在Windows上,发现分区格式不支持。又一阵紧张,万一USB硬盘盒不能支持EFI分区,难不成我得找一台Mac Pro?在鼎好找了家苹果专卖店,将USB硬盘盒接到MBP上,结果能认出来,总算放心了。Time-Capsule是不敢买了,和老婆商量了一下,不如搞个准系统,用opensolaris/zfs自己攒一台Home NAS。在网上搜到了一家“北京准系统大本营”的店家,上周末和朋友约好一起去转转。

我起先买的是AOpen S180机箱(最多可放3块3.5寸的硬盘),加翔升的Atom 330套板(支持4个SATA-II接口)。回到家发现,CPU的风扇和机箱的风扇噪音比较大。问了下朋友,他买的浩鑫的SG33G5整机噪音比较小。不过价钱也贵出一大节,机箱/电源+主板就要1,950。和老婆合计了一下,咬了咬牙,换!第二天去E世界,换了SG33G5,上的是E1500双核赛扬处理器(330元)。

回到家,发现板载的Marvell网卡,solaris缺省不支持,需要第三方驱动。安装好了之后,以为总算是大功告成了。不过发现,Leopard上的Finder访问NFS巨慢无比。绝望地以为,是网卡驱动支持得不好。后来发现,从solaris上scp,速度还是很快的,google了一下,发现是Mac OS的固疾,再次鄙视Apple一下!最后花了一晚上,把TC硬盘上的东西,scp到solaris上。下一步,是要给rpool做mirror,被吓怕了。貌似有些麻烦,放假时再整了 ...

最近去村里买东西,都很不顺利,总要跑两遍,郁闷 ...

13 thoughts on “Home NAS basing on OpenSolaris/ZFS

  1. Windows 下不能读硬盘纯粹是因为它不支持 HFS+ 而已,装个 MacDrive 软件就行了。

    参考 James Gosling 这篇 http://blogs.sun.com/jag/entry/nfs_on_snow_leopard 配置一下 NFS 的锁?应该能提升不少性能。

    另外如果可以按 Samba 导出,那读写性能应该会不错的,这个我专门测过。

    其实如果你觉得 scp 快那完全可以用 sshfs 来访问文件。

  2. 按照james的方法试验了一下,重启之后,写入还是很慢,samba也重新试验了一下,也是写入很慢 :(

  3. 哈哈,今天才发现blog搬家到这里了 :-) 希望资料能找回来,宝贝儿的照片视频还有电子书,可比机器珍贵呀

  4. 可以去http://timecapsuledead.org/ 这里登记你的TC了,呵呵

    btw:下面的Captcha好像有点问题啊,点了大框框去了一个报错的页面。。。

  5. 我自己也打算攒台NAS的,不过因为预算问题放弃了。直接拿我的HTPC当下载机以及NAS。

  6. timecapsule的电源可以修的,拿到电子市场维修的地方换个电容就可以了,加上手续费估计就几十块钱。

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

To submit your comment, click the image below where it asks you to...
Clickcha - The One-Click Captcha